Many businesses struggle with the harmful environmental impact of traditional pigments. Heavy metals and synthetic dyes pose pollution risks, regulatory challenges, and consumer backlash, making it crucial for companies to find sustainable alternatives.
Green iron oxide is a non-toxic, eco-friendly pigment derived from iron oxide, known for its durability and vibrant color. It is widely used in coatings, plastics, and construction materials, which allows companies to enhance their product offerings sustainably.
